Who is Kate Manser?

Riding into DC's Bronze Age in the pages of Weird Western Tales #48 (1978), Kate Manser is a frontier figure brought to life by the classic creative team of Gerry Conway and Dick Ayers — a pairing that knew how to make the Old West feel genuinely dangerous and alive. Over a span stretching all the way to 2012, she's proven to have real staying power for a character with a relatively slim footprint, turning up across titles as varied as Guy Gardner: Warrior and DC Universe: Legacies and sharing pages with icons like Batman, Green Lantern, and The Flash. With at least one collector-recognized key issue to her name, Kate Manser is exactly the kind of deep-catalog discovery that rewards the fan willing to dig past the headliners into DC's rich, sprawling history.
